Задать вопрос

Ввести возраст человека (от 1 до 150 лет) и вывести его вместе с последующим словом "год","года" или "лет".

+3
Ответы (1)
  1. 1 октября, 06:28
    0
    Program v;

    var

    age : Integer;

    begin

    WriteLn ('Возраст: '); ReadLn (age);

    Write ('Вам ', age, ' ');

    if age=11 then WriteLn ('лет');

    if age=12 then WriteLn ('лет');

    if age=13 then WriteLn ('лет');

    if age=14 then WriteLn ('лет');

    if age mod 10=1 then WriteLn ('год');

    if age mod 10=2 then WriteLn ('года');

    if age mod 10=3 then WriteLn ('года');

    if age mod 10=4 then WriteLn ('года');

    if age mod 10=5 then WriteLn ('лет');

    if age mod 10=6 then WriteLn ('лет');

    if age mod 10=7 then WriteLn ('лет');

    if age mod 10=8 then WriteLn ('лет');

    if age mod 10=9 then WriteLn ('лет');

    if age mod 10=0 then WriteLn ('лет');

    end.
Знаешь ответ на этот вопрос?
Сомневаешься в правильности ответа?
Получи верный ответ на вопрос 🏆 «Ввести возраст человека (от 1 до 150 лет) и вывести его вместе с последующим словом "год","года" или "лет". ...» по предмету 📕 Информатика, используя встроенную систему поиска. Наша обширная база готовых ответов поможет тебе получить необходимые сведения!
Найти готовые ответы
Похожие вопросы информатике
Напишите программу на языке Паскаля для задачи: Ввести возраст человека (от 1 до 150) и ввести его вместе с последующими словами "год" года" "лет". Пример: Введите возраст: 24 Вам 24 года.
Ответы (1)
Ввести число от 5 до 9. Вывести его значение словом. Составить программу для решения приведенного ниже задания двумя способами, используя: а) команду выбора case; б) команду if. Ввести число от 5 до 9. Вывести его значение словом.
Ответы (1)
Задача 1 - Дано целое число. Если оно положительное, вывести " Число положительное ", если отрицательное вывести "Число отрицательное ", если равно 0 - "Число равно нулю" задача 2 - дано целое число.
Ответы (1)
Ввести 2 числа используя оператор ввода данных read (). Перед оператором read () обязательно вывести объяснения значения какой переменной надо ввести (Например, writeln ('vvedite a'); ). Ввести их через запятую.
Ответы (1)
ввести 3 стороны треугольника, вывести его площадь. (на языке паскаль) ввести число, вывести квалратный корень.
Ответы (1)